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5320 4408 00738
21584209 327785
21584209 327785
5025329 015275121 413232520
All about undefined
Interested in learning more?
21584209 327785
5025329 015275121 413232520
See more
10196654929 4840901 7345
4976 01593866 00
See more
02085856970 35725839786
89018908287 097313 191617639
See more